62% of the 60652 zip code residents lived in the same house 5 years ago. Out of people who lived in different houses, 91% lived in this county. Out of people who lived in different counties, 50% lived in Illinois.
97% of the 60652 zip code residents lived in the same house 1 year ago. Out of people who lived in different houses, 92% moved from this county. Out of people who lived in different houses, 5% moved from different county within same state. Out of people who lived in different houses, 9% moved from different state. Out of people who lived in different houses, 4% moved from abroad.

2002 - 2018 National Fire Incident Reporting System (NFIRS) incidents
According to the data from the years 2002 - 2018 the average number of fires per year is 90. The highest number of fires - 139 took place in 2009, and the least - 0 in 2005. The data has a declining trend.
When looking into fire subcategories, the most incidents belonged to: Structure Fires (40.9%), and Mobile Property/Vehicle Fires (22.0%).
